Abstract
The increasing demand for higher output efficiency coupled with rising material costs have forced man-made structures to be very critically designed.Components are now pushed to their limits, having to operate at higher stress levels and in more severe environments. Moreover, the conseque-nces at stake should a component fail are now greater than ever. Hence their design has to conform to the higher stan-dards of safety demanded.
